Riots In Kenosha Turn Deadly Overnight

The riots in Kenosha turned deadly Tuesday night as two people were shot and killed and one person injured. Kenosha Police are looking for a male suspect, armed with a long gun. The shootings took place just before midnight. A third individual shot was receiving medical attention, but the injury did not appear to be life-threatening. Authorities believe surveillance video obtained from the shooting will assist in arresting the shooter soon. Governor Tony Evers ordered 250 National Guard Members to Kenosha on Tuesday to assist law enforcement officers, as the protests drag in the fourth day.
